Position Overview As a Tire Technician, you'll play a key role in replacing, repairing, and rotating tires on customer vehicles. This position offers hands-on training geared towards helping you build the skills needed for more advanced roles. Key Responsibilities Install and repair tires. Operate balancers and tire machines. Complete work orders accurately. Maintain and organize the shop and equipment. Assist customers and co-workers as needed. Provide outstanding customer service, and meet the customer needs. Promote a safe and collaborative work environment.
Requirements:
Requirements Service-oriented attitude and strong work ethic. Team collaboration skills and ability to follow instructions. Ability to stand for long periods, bend, and lift up to 75 lbs. Available to work Saturdays. Authorized to work in the USA (18+). Comfortable with occasional mechanical hazards and outdoor conditions.
